Has Comic-Con Nuked the Fridge?

Amidst all the movie hype, some Comic-Con attendees grumbled that the convention has lost sight of the comic books it was started to showcase.
125,000 fans and fanboys struggled their way through traffic jams and back home through epic airport delays in order to attend the just-wrapped Comic-Con 2008. But amidst all the movie hype, some attendees grumbled that this was the year the convention finally lost sight of the comic books it was actually started to showcase. This week on the IFC News podcast, we look at what’s changed for Comic-Con, why it’s gotten so much press attention this year and which movies everyone’s been talking about.
